Output 843b9bd265e40a9de5884cd472cc9ade81f540040234272f340d8a7424178193:0

value
655430460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bb89a77765cd270cc7185090619cac92f13f7d5 OP_EQUAL
address
3Mio42GbL5oqHkPk4qBKmhcZ5WXb3pK9zc
transaction
843b9bd265e40a9de5884cd472cc9ade81f540040234272f340d8a7424178193
spent
true